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
173316 0915311936 73679202112 37311614
86269 7372310 723335
86269 7372310 723335
8099642311 73161 619145
All about undefined
Interested in learning more?
86269 7372310 723335
8099642311 73161 619145
See more
061878341 4136 0349992697
897130 615447884 84
See more
019044 04905956 574
015 0892 01 91049717866 243
See more